JAKARTA - Facing the police report that has been submitted by the Icel party regarding the alleged sexual violence, actor Anrez Adelio showed a very cooperative attitude. He stated that he was ready to follow all applicable legal processes.
"What is going on, we will go through the legal process," said Anrez in South Jakarta, Monday, February 2.
Currently, he admitted that he had not received an official summons from the police.
"Not yet, I'm still waiting," he said.
He is very looking forward to the summoning moment. For him, this is an opportunity to be able to provide clarification and tell the story from his point of view.
"I'm waiting for the police call for clarification," he continued.
Anrez feels that until now the public has only heard stories from one side. This is of course very detrimental to his position.
"Because it's not good either, because until now the public has only heard one-sided. Only one party was heard," he said.
He believes that after he gives his statement, there will be a balance of information.
"And I feel that there will be a time," he said hopefully.
Furthermore, Anrez Adelio tried to clearly separate between the ongoing legal affairs and his personal affairs with Icel. He emphasized that his intention to communicate was purely for humanitarian reasons.
When the Icel party stated that they only wanted to focus on the legal process, Anrez tried to provide an understanding. For him, the two things can run in parallel.
"The legal process should run, I will not interfere with it. Here I am talking personally," he explained.
He felt that legal affairs could be handed over to lawyers. However, personal affairs concerning the fate of a child must be discussed from heart to heart.
"The problem is that if it's like that, I can just ask my legal advisor to his legal advisor. It's just that what I want is not that," he said.
His intention to be present at the birth was a personal gesture, not part of a legal strategy.
"What I was talking about yesterday is this is about you, me and the child. Is it personal?" he said.
He wants to show that beyond his status as a reporter, he is still a man who cares about the condition of women who are pregnant with his child.
Unfortunately, this good intention does not seem to be accepted. The Icel party prefers to close the door of personal communication and focus on the legal path.
